I think I've figured out how to change and re-assign player & team chants

Not particularly revolutionary, but it should be a nice addition for MVP 94 & other total conversion mods

To change a team chant open chanthdr.big with a hex editor

Near the beginning is the list of team chants

92 60 01 00 is Anaheim

92 60 1E 00 is Philadelphia

So if you wanted to have "Let's go angels" be chanted when the Phillies are playing (I don't know why you'd want to, but just for example)

You'd change "01 00" to "1E 00" (Phillies being team #30 30=001E in hex)

If I can figure out how to add chants (rather than just replace), For something like Total Classics, this could mean team chants for many of the 90 teams in the 'minor league' levels

In the case of MVP 94, this means the Expos will get a chant replacing the Diamondbacks (Washington have no team chant at all in MVP 05, the expos chant is taken from MVP 04)

Extracting and Importing sound files in chantdat.big is done using "extractor"

Player Chants are listed in chanthdr.big starting with 90 60 04 00 (Bobby Abreu) up to 90 60 74 08 (Billy Williams)

So to give Abreu's "Let's go bobby" change to Bobby Bonilla change "04 00" to "5E 00"

In MVP 94, by replacing chants with extractor I am adding the "Let's go Barry" chant for Bonds & Larkin from MVP 03 (replacing player chants for guys like Ichiro that aren't in MVP 94)

So far I can only replace a chant with an already existing chant, perhaps there are chants from other EA games that could be used, I'll have a look into FIFA 06/07 to see if there's anything that could be used (like Jose)

So maybe an updated chant file could be included in MVP 07 to give some of the newer players some chants.

Yea, there's a few other chants at the start of the file

"Beat the Backs" "Beat LA" "MVP" "Over-rated" "Larry" & the Braves tomahawk chant.

I haven't figured out how to re-assign those yet.

As for Barry Bonds his chant was removed in MVP 04 when he was replaced with "Jon Dowd"

I use SX and a hex editor

add "00"s to each audio file (at EOF) to make it a multiple of 256

copy /b *.dat newaudiofile.dat

put the header at the end of the main audio file (add "00" to the front of it to make it 256 bytes)

space (whatever is needed to = 256) & "48 72 49 6e" & HDR & "48 72 53 7a 00 00 00 54"

You also need to hex edit the offsets in the header, and file size

94a4 header

0f00* team ID

0210* # of announcements ( 02 always the same 10 = # of announcements in HEX)

0000 place holder

df01* file size (Convert to little endian, multiply by 256, add 256 = file size)

0000 place holder

0000 offset 1st audio file aways 0000*

Each audio announcement contains two value sets, 1st offset(above) 2nd type *

0700 Unknown but always the same

0000 Unknown but always the same

BFAF Unknown but always the same

0000 Unknown but always the same

Lines with * is stuff you have to edit, I'm been playing with a program that will make the hdr for you based on audio files. But I'm a couple days away from a release
